Bergenfield FAQ

How many clients can I see at once in Bergenfield?

Instructional home occupations may host only one student at a time. Permitted resident professional offices may have up to two persons total employed at the site.

Can I hire non-resident employees?

Resident professional offices in permitted categories may have no more than two persons employed total, including the resident; broader employment is not allowed in a home occupation.

Garfield FAQ

Are there limits on how many clients can visit my home business?

Yes, but limits are set by your municipality, not Bergen County. Most towns cap daily visits and restrict on-street parking for home occupations.

When does Bergen County get involved in home business traffic?

Only when your property accesses a county road or causes drainage or safety impacts to county infrastructure. Otherwise, traffic rules are municipal.
